Job Description

What you will do:

- To provide project management expertise to manage the ongoing coordination and implementation of the global RCM project.
- To ensure the APAC RCM remains current, accurate and consistent with approaches taken in other jurisdictions.
- To be responsible for working with First and Second Lines of Defence to identify the key risks, controls and monitoring to be undertaken, to address the risks presented by the requirements the different business lines are subject to.

- Engagement with APAC Compliance teams to enhance or develop, as appropriate (on an ongoing basis), the following elements within the RCM tool:

  • Regulatory requirements / environment
  • Inherent risk assessments
  • Controls
  • Policies and procedures
  • Residual risk assessments
  • Issues management
  • Monitoring and testing approach

- Develop and maintain local procedures and approach documents with regards to the RCM framework and use of the RCM tool.

- To continue to evolve the RCM tool in an agile manner.

- To provide relevant business manager support to APAC Compliance.
- To take up any ad hoc projects or tasks as assigned from time to time.

- Reviewing, analysing and mapping data.

- Assist in Compliance periodic reporting across regions.

- Produce MI for Governance packs.

Must have:

- Strong data analytical skills

- Strong attention to detail

- Ability to multi-task

- Ability to meet deadlines and work under pressure

- Effective communicator both verbally and in writing

- Ability and willingness to accept accountability and ownership, demonstrate initiative, work with limited direct supervision and support effective and efficient cross-unit co-operation

- Good working knowledge of Microsoft Office products

Nice to have:

- Ideally educated to at least first degree level with a relevant degree, hold a recognised relevant professional qualification.

- Experience working in Compliance
